Transaction 9ad5423d1b63f88e31ead605136ebf35c00949dfd47cf3271366e986aa0c0e9c

2 Input
2 Outputs
  • 9ad5423d1b63f88e31ead605136ebf35c00949dfd47cf3271366e986aa0c0e9c:0
  • value  19958382
    address  37WWZaBh5yb3r6cuvLrUc5XqNBD1gR68p2
  • 9ad5423d1b63f88e31ead605136ebf35c00949dfd47cf3271366e986aa0c0e9c:1
  • value  2244807505
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g